## v3.8.2 — Key Rotation for LinkLattice Deep-Link Router

As part of our quarterly security cycle at Verrow Mobile, the signing key used to validate deep-link route manifests has been rotated. All manifests published before this release remain valid until the grace window closes on the next minor version. New contractors should note that builds signed with the retired key will be rejected by the router's verification stage. Re-sign all pending manifests using the new key below.

rollout seal: bky4_x7Gc

Ticket: TumbleVault locker access flow — plugin hook review

External plugin authors: the new pre-unlock hook fires before PIN validation, so any plugin touching locker state must be idempotent and must not block longer than 200 ms. Please review carefully before integrating. This change cannot ship without written sign-off from the approver named below.

named custodian: Brivan Eliath Quenox Frador

## Deploying the Gatewick Proctor Queue

Deploys are pretty painless: push to main, wait for the pipeline, then watch the queue drain dashboard for five minutes. If candidates pile up mid-exam, roll back first and ask questions later — the queue replays safely. Everything the workers care about lives in one config block, shown here for reference.

settings of bafof-yagef:
JOROX_PIN=8740
JOROX_TENANT=pelox
JOROX_METRICS_HOST=metrics.jorox.qorvelworks.internal
JOROX_SEAL=seal_c78f63c1
JOROX_STANDBY_TEAM=norax

## Authentication

Heads up: the nightly reindex job (`reindex_nightly.py`) talks to the Lanternfish search cluster, and that cluster won't accept anonymous writes anymore — we locked it down last sprint. The job now authenticates as the `reindex-runner` service identity against Corvid Gateway, and the token is injected via the `LF_INDEX_TOKEN` env var in the scheduler config. Nothing clever going on, just a bearer header on every batch request. For review purposes, the staging credential currently in use is listed below.

service key, kadug-kadup: kto15_rN23XLAYImmZgrJ